Our take

Bitcoin.com Wallet

The Bitcoin.com Wallet provides an accessible entry point into decentralized asset storage, balancing retail convenience with true non-custodial ownership. Since its launch in 2017 under the broader Bitcoin.com brand, the application has evolved from a dedicated Bitcoin Cash and Bitcoin client into a versatile multi-chain software wallet. It handles prominent smart contract environments including Ethereum, Polygon, and Avalanche, giving users direct access to decentralized applications through WalletConnect.

While the interface streamlines daily asset transfers and decentralized token swaps, users must recognize the operational boundaries inherent to non-custodial software. Bitcoin.com does not manage user funds, hold recovery phrases, or execute order routing internally. Instead, fiat on-ramps and cross-chain conversions depend entirely on external partners that apply separate fees and spreads. For individuals seeking straightforward mobile self-custody without complex node management, it delivers dependable utility.

wealthsimple

Wealthsimple Crypto delivers a highly regulated, user-friendly entry point for Canadian residents wishing to acquire and stake digital assets. Operating under Wealthsimple Investments Inc., a member of the Canadian Investment Regulatory Organization (CIRO), the service eliminates the counterparty ambiguity common among offshore venues. By routing orders through qualified third-party liquidity providers and holding assets with institutional custodians, the platform prioritizes compliance and account simplicity over low-margin trading tools. While operations are transparent and tightly aligned with Canadian provincial regulations, the operational model comes with clear trade-offs. Trading fee spreads sit between 0.50% and 2.00% depending on your overall account balance tier. Wealthsimple serves as a straightforward, custody-managed environment for long-term investors rather than a high-frequency trading terminal.

Supported networks and asset depth

Bitcoin.com Wallet

The Bitcoin.com Wallet functions as a multi-asset non-custodial client available across iOS, Android, and web environments. Originally engineered around Bitcoin and Bitcoin Cash, the wallet now supports major layer-one and layer-two networks including Ethereum, Polygon, Avalanche C-Chain, and BNB Smart Chain. Within these smart contract ecosystems, users can store, receive, and transfer thousands of native tokens, ERC-20 assets, and network-compatible stablecoins such as USDT and USDC. Network selection happens seamlessly within the interface, allowing separate accounts for individual chains.

In addition to basic balance tracking and transfers, the wallet integrates decentralized application connectivity through WalletConnect. This feature allows mobile users to interface with decentralized exchanges, lending pools, and NFT marketplaces without exposing private keys. Built-in decentralized swapping functionality connects to aggregated liquidity protocols, enabling token trades across supported chains directly within the mobile view. However, users seeking deep support for non-EVM alternative chains like Solana, Cardano, or Cosmos will find the ecosystem scope restricted strictly to supported UTXO and EVM networks.

wealthsimple

Wealthsimple Crypto operates as a restricted dealer platform integrated into the broader Wealthsimple financial suite. Clients can buy, sell, and hold dozens of popular digital assets, including Bitcoin, Ethereum, Solana, and prominent decentralized finance tokens. Rather than operating its own central limit order book, Wealthsimple connects to external, regulated liquidity market makers to execute retail transactions. This execution model allows straightforward market order processing directly inside the mobile application and web interface.

Beyond basic spot trading, the platform offers native staking functionality for select proof-of-stake cryptocurrencies, such as Ethereum and Solana. When users opt into staking, their assets participate in network validation to generate yield, subject to standard protocol unbonding periods and platform operational fees. Advanced derivatives, margin borrowing, and synthetic token pairs are intentionally excluded from the product line to maintain adherence to Canadian provincial regulatory frameworks.

Transaction fees and conversion costs

Bitcoin.com Wallet

Downloading, installing, and generating accounts within the Bitcoin.com Wallet incurs no upfront platform cost. As a non-custodial client, the software does not levy internal account maintenance, deposit, or withdrawal fees. Whenever a user initiates an on-chain transfer, they pay the underlying blockchain network gas fee directly to network validators or miners. The interface allows users to customize these network fees across multiple priority tiers, letting them balance transaction confirmation speed against network costs during periods of high blockchain congestion.

Financial expenses arise predominantly when utilizing integrated third-party commercial services. Purchasing crypto with local fiat currency involves outside partners such as MoonPay, Banxa, or Transak, depending on the visitor jurisdiction. These payment processors apply credit card processing fees, bank transfer surcharges, and dynamic exchange rate markups that vary significantly by payment channel and territory. Similarly, decentralized token swaps executed via in-app aggregators incorporate small routing fees alongside necessary network gas expenses. The wallet displays estimated totals before confirmation, though underlying market volatility can influence final execution figures.

wealthsimple

Pricing on Wealthsimple Crypto uses a tiered percentage markup built directly into the buy and sell quotes. Standard Core tier clients, holding less than CAD 100,000 in total Wealthsimple assets, pay an operational fee of 2.00% per trade. Premium tier clients holding between CAD 100,000 and CAD 500,000 benefit from a reduced 1.00% fee, while Generation tier clients with more than CAD 500,000 experience a 0.50% fee schedule. These transaction fees apply equally to purchases and sales across all supported tokens.

Depositing Canadian dollars into the platform incurs zero platform surcharges via Interac e-Transfer, direct bank deposit, or linked debit connections. Staking services apply an administrative fee deducted from the gross protocol rewards generated by the network. While internal transfers between Wealthsimple financial accounts are free, external on-chain crypto withdrawals require payment of dynamic network miner fees, which vary based on real-time blockchain congestion at the time of broadcast.

Security architecture and key management

Bitcoin.com Wallet

Security within the Bitcoin.com Wallet rests on an uncompromising self-custody framework. Private keys generate locally on the user device through an industry-standard 12-word recovery phrase. Neither Bitcoin.com nor any related corporate entity maintains access to private credentials, transaction histories, or account balances. This model protects holders from centralized platform insolvency, yet it requires users to shoulder total personal responsibility for secret phrase preservation, physical device security, and wallet backup integrity.

To simplify key management for retail participants, the application includes an automated cloud backup system alongside standard manual paper backups. This mechanism encrypts the 12-word seed phrase with a user-chosen master password before syncing it to Google Drive or Apple iCloud. While this feature reduces the risk of accidental device loss, it shifts partial risk to the user cloud account and master password strength. Local app access can be fortified using biometric authentication, including fingerprint scanning and facial recognition, alongside personal PIN protection. Notably, mobile editions lack native hardware wallet integration, meaning cold-storage validation requires external desktop configurations.

wealthsimple

Wealthsimple Crypto employs a custodial architecture where digital assets are held on behalf of users rather than through individual private key management. The platform partners with established institutional sub-custodians, including Coinbase Custody and BitGo Trust Company, to helps protect the vast majority of client digital balances in segregated offline cold storage facilities. These specialized sub-custodians maintain commercial crime insurance policies designed to cover specific operational vulnerabilities, internal theft, and physical facility breaches. However, these commercial policies do not protect against market depreciation, standard asset price fluctuations, network protocol failures, or individual account credential compromises resulting from phishing or device theft.

Account-level protection incorporates mandatory two-factor authentication, biometric mobile login capabilities, and ongoing session monitoring to mitigate unauthorized portal access. Users should note that while fiat cash balances held in linked Wealthsimple accounts may receive Canadian Investor Protection Fund or CDIC coverage under qualifying conditions, digital currency holdings are explicitly not covered by CIPF or CDIC protection. Account holders seeking absolute asset sovereignty can utilize blockchain transfer capabilities to move supported digital assets off the platform into private hardware wallets, balancing convenient custodial execution with personal control options.

Geographic availability and client support

Bitcoin.com Wallet

Because the core software wallet operates in a non-custodial manner, the open-source software client can be downloaded globally across most international mobile app storefronts. Users do not need to submit identity verification documents, complete Know Your Customer checks, or register personal telephone numbers merely to initialize the wallet and manage private keys. This unencumbered distribution aligns with decentralized software standards, facilitating cross-border access across diverse regulatory environments.

However, identity rules apply strictly when accessing integrated fiat gateways, debit card purchase rails, or localized banking features. Third-party payment intermediaries must comply with regional financial regulations, anti-money laundering standards, and local licensing mandates. Consequently, visitors in restricted jurisdictions or sanctioned territories may find fiat purchases disabled even though underlying software wallet functions persist. Customer support options reflect self-custody operational realities: assistance is delivered primarily via an online help desk, self-service knowledge base documentation, and ticketed email queues rather than round-the-clock live telephone operators.

wealthsimple

Wealthsimple Crypto is offered exclusively to legal Canadian residents who have reached the age of majority in their specific province or territory. Prospective account holders must complete mandatory identity verification in accordance with Canadian know-your-customer regulations and FINTRAC anti-money laundering standards. Because the platform operates under oversight from the Canadian Investment Regulatory Organization and provincial securities administrators, specific retail client protection rules apply. For instance, retail investors in most provinces are subject to annual net purchase limits on non-exempt digital assets, whereas major established tokens such as Bitcoin and Ethereum remain exempt from these caps across Canadian jurisdictions.

Customer support services are delivered through a searchable online knowledge base, virtual chat assistants, and live digital agents accessible during Canadian business hours. Email ticketing and in-app messaging handle routine account inquiries, verification requests, and deposit troubleshooting. Wealthsimple also simplifies annual tax compliance by providing downloadable transaction histories, realized capital gain reports, and staking income statements formatted for Canada Revenue Agency filings. The unified account infrastructure helps support that Canadian users can monitor their digital asset activity alongside traditional registered retirement savings and tax-free savings plans without maintaining disparate logins or independent third-party tax calculation tools.

Who it suits

Bitcoin.com Wallet

The Bitcoin.com Wallet suits retail cryptocurrency investors seeking an intuitive mobile application that combines independent private key custody with multi-chain flexibility. It provides practical daily utility for individuals who frequently transact in Bitcoin or Bitcoin Cash while also participating in major EVM decentralized finance protocols across Ethereum and Polygon.

However, the application is less fitting for advanced institutional operators requiring multi-signature enterprise governance or strict air-gapped cold-storage hardware integrations on mobile. Traders seeking comprehensive technical charting suites, complex derivatives execution, or native support for non-EVM networks like Solana will prefer specialized trading platforms or chain-specific web3 interfaces.

wealthsimple

Wealthsimple Crypto is designed for Canadian residents who prioritize regulatory compliance and seamless integration with existing financial accounts over advanced trading tools. It serves casual participants and long-term accumulators who prefer straightforward spot purchases funded directly through Canadian bank accounts and Interac e-Transfers. Users who manage their equities, automated portfolios, and daily cash transactions within the Wealthsimple mobile app will appreciate the consolidated interface. The service fits investors looking for custodial simplicity and automated tax documentation for Canadian filing requirements. However, active traders seeking low maker-taker fees, deep order books, or specialized charting tools may find the platform limited for frequent market execution.
